What blew fuse open:
Overheated power supply capacitors went short or missing... The way this module is built with fins you can yell it's a hotty

Blower for Comand & display has a FILTER
Did you see a vent duct blowing air through your screen heatsink.... there is a small blower with a tiny filter directly to the right: check its condition: time for service?

PWM Blower controller heatsink
Next time you go in to replace your cabin filter (and dust-off tiny Display/Comand filter) drop out the blower "resistor" to check for white aluminum oxidation of the heatsink by rain egress.
